The Occupational Therapist (OT) works in collaboration with the client, caregivers and family to facilitate, restore and/or maintain the patient/clients optimal level of function in the areas of self-care, productivity and leisure. UBC's Master of Occupational Therapy (MOT) program is a full-time, two-year professional master's degree program, and the only occupational therapy degree program in British Columbia. There are 64 seats in MOT Vancouver cohort, 16 seats in the MOT North cohort (Prince George), and 16 seats in MOT Fraser cohort (Surrey).
